Релиз ZennoDroid Pro — Финальный релиз!

ZennoLab Team

Super Moderator
Команда форума
Регистрация
22.01.2019
Сообщения
1 501
Благодарностей
3 748
Баллы
113



ZennoDroid Pro выходит из бета-тестирования!

Друзья!

Мы рады сообщить о финальном релизе многопоточной версии ZennoDroid Pro

Это значит, что программа выходит из фазы бета-тестирования и переходит в стабильную версию, где исправлены все критические ошибки.
  • Исследуйте новые источники трафика
  • Создавайте аккаунты там, где нельзя это сделать с обычного браузера
  • Автоматизируйте любые действия в Android-приложениях и получайте в сотни раз больше результатов, чем ваши конкуренты.

ZennoDroid Pro уже доступен к покупке в личном кабинете.

Стоимость

ZennoDroid Lite $97 \ год
ZennoDroid Pro $197 \ год

Если Вы никогда не пользовались ZennoDroid или не уверены, что он вам подойдет, скачайте демо-версию.

Купить сейчас


Апгрейды

Lite-версия приобретена до 5 августа

Переход осуществляется через личный кабинет.
В ближайший месяц стоимость апгрейда Lite -> Pro составит $100 с учетом оставшихся дней подписки.

Например, у вас осталось 60 дней подписки и вы хотите перейти на ZennoDroid Pro.
Тогда цена составит: ($197 — $97) * (60 дней / 365 дней) = $21.22

Lite-версия приобретена после 5 августа

Стоимость апгрейда составит 127$.
Допустим, у вас есть ZennoDroid Lite, у которого осталось 310 дней подписки, и вы хотите перейти на ZennoDroid Pro. Тогда цена составит: $127 * (310 дней / 365 дней) = $109

Сделать апгрейд

Эмуляция Android в несколько потоков - ZennoDroid Pro

Описание?

Это значит, что Вы сможете решать больше интересных задач на платформе Android, запуская десятки проектов параллельно друг другу! Количество потоков неограниченно, всё упирается только в ресурсы вашего железа.

Как использовать многопоток?


Один поток программы может работать только с одной копией эмулятора. Это значит, вам потребуется создать столько копий эмулятора, сколько собираетесь использовать потоков, плюс один дополнительный для ProjectMaker. Как это сделать?

  1. Рассчитайте, на сколько Виртуальных Машин (ВМ) у вас достаточно памяти
  2. Создайте одну виртуальную машину в MEmu самостоятельно. Она нужна для ProjectMaker
  3. В начале проекта добавьте действие "Создание вирт. машины".
  4. Вторым шагом используйте действий "Выбрать" для выбора только что созданной машины
  5. Запустите ВМ с помощью действия "Запустить \ Перезапустить"
  6. Удалите ВМ через экшен "Удалить", если она вам больше не нужна
Если вы хотите использовать уже существующие вирт. машины (по сути сохраненные профили):
  1. Выберите ВМ (конкретную или произвольную из существующих)
  2. Используйте ВМ с помощью действия "Выбрать"

Пример расчёта требований к ресурам:
Допустим, у вас 16Гб RAM. Около 4 Гб занимает ОС + программы, значит доступно около 12Гб. Если вы создаете ВМ по 2Гб, вы сможете создать их 6шт - 5шт для ZennoDroid и 1шт для ProjectMaker.


Первым шагом мы создаём виртуальную машину



Далее нам необходимо сообщить ZennoDroid какую именно машину мы хотим запустить. Для этого на втором шаге используем действий "Выбрать" и указываем переменную с индексом или именем только что созданной ВМ.

Если оставить поле пустым, ZennoDroid автоматически выберет случайную свободную ВМ.



И заключительный шаг - запускаем нашу виртуальную машину.



Используя такую логику в многопоточном режиме, каждый поток будет создавать для себя отдельную ВМ и работать с ней.


______________________________________________________

По завершению работы, если ВМ вам больше не нужна - вы можете удалить её с помощью действия с виртуальными машинами "Удалить".


Включает в себя все преимущества ZennoPoster 7

Обновлённый редактор кода и поддержка новой версии языка C# 7.3
Обновлен компонент редактора кода. Это позволило повысить стабильность работы, устранить множество мелких недочетов и повысить удобство.

Также, обновился компилятор C# с версии 5.0 до 7.3. С новыми доступными возможностями языка Вы можете ознакомиться на официальном сайте docs.microsoft.com:


Совершенно новый планировщик заданий
Настраивайте расписание любой сложности: график выполнения, временные интервалы и способ повторного выполнения проекта.
Узнать подробнее о настройке расписания




Умный поиск действий и функций
Вам не нужно помнить, где располагалось и как называлось действие или функция, ведь в новой панели действий встроен действительно “умный поиск“. Начните набирать желаемое действие и результатах отобразится наиболее релевантный экшен с уже выбранной опцией. Просто перенести его в проект с помощью enter, двойного клика или drag&drop.




Поддержка Google-таблиц
  • Храните в гугловских таблицах данные, которые будут доступны всем шаблонам.
  • Настройте парсинг данных в таблицу и просматривайте результат с телефона.
  • Создавайте для клиентов удобные отчёты, которыми легко делиться.
  • Организуйте онлайн мониторинг.
  • И множество других возможностей, которые открываются с долгожданной интеграцией Google Sheets.


Новая система просмотра эмуляторов
Новый режим отображения миниатюр всех запущенных эмуляторов, в котором Вы можете наблюдать за работающими потоками в одном окне.

Каждый проект имеет вкладку «Инстансы», на которой отображаются изображения всех работающих потоков проекта в реальном времени, со статусом выполнения:
  • Подготовка
  • Выполнение
  • Ожидание действия пользователя
  • Ошибка
  • Успех
Чтобы посмотреть процесс работы конкретного эмулятора, необходимо кликнуть 2 раз по его миниатюре.





Интегрированная справка

В ProjectMaker появилась интегрированная справка, которую Вы можете найти по значку (?) в заголовке почти любого окна. По клику откроется справочная информация об инструменте или выбранном действии. Это будет полезно всем пользователям, которые только начинают осваивать программу или делать свои первые шаги в Android-автоматизации.

Пока еще не все статьи написаны и обновлены, но уже сейчас будет полезно иметь некоторые справочные материалы под рукой.




Гибкая настройка интерфейса
Настройте программу под себя: 14 тем оформления, включая темную тему для снятия напряжения с глаз в ночное время суток. Индивидуальная настройка меню и расположения окон.
Узнать подробнее о настройке интерфейса


Сортировка Drag & Drop в окне переменных

Добавлена возможность ручной сортировки переменных в ProjectMaker: курсором или кнопками "Вверх" и "Вниз". Свой порядок работает тогда, когда выключена сортировка по столбцам (для этого нажмите на кнопку "Очистка сортировки").




Новое действие: HTTP-запросы

Ранее такие запросы как PUT, DELETE, HEAD, OPTIONS, PATH, TRACE были доступны только из C# кода. Начиная с этой версии, Вы можете выполнить любой из этих HTTP-методов с помощью одного экшена - HTTP-запросы.




Отключение действий

Добавлена возможность отключения экшена в ProjectMaker через контекстное меню. При этом экшен помечается серым и не участвует в выполнении проекта даже в ZennoPoster.




Цветные сообщения в логе

В экшене "Оповещение" добавлена возможность указать цвет сообщения. А в окне лога появилась фильтрация по цвету.



Возможность сохранения и восстановления данных приложения

Сохраняйте пользовательские данные приложения (сессию, кеш), которые хранят в себе все данные авторизации приложения (профиль). Такие бекапы весят очень мало, что позволяет создавать много аккаунтов и использовать их на 1 эмуляторе, просто сохраняя и загружая сессии.

Новое действие находится в разделе Добавить действие → Android → Утилиты → Сохранение данных приложения и Восстановление данных приложения.






Новое действие: Масштабирование

Управляйте масштабом в приложениях, эмулируя движение двух пальцев по экрану. Новое действие находится в разделе Android → Утилиты → Масштабирование. Для его настройки требуется выбрать действие - приблизить \ отдалить, и указать координаты, относительных которых будет произведено масштабирование. По умолчанию - центр экрана.

Коэффициент характеризует мощность масштабирования. Чем больше, тем сильнее эффект. По умолчанию используется значение 1.0.




Новое действие: Общие папки

Назначайте собственные пути для директорий скачивания, музыки, галереи и видео. Новое действие находится в разделе Android → Действие с вирт. машиной → Общие папки. Для успешного применения настроек, требуется выполнить действие до запуска вирт. машины.




Добавлено сохранение индекса и имени ВМ (виртуальной машины) в переменную

Сохраняйте имя ВМ или индекс в переменную для дальнейшего отслеживания при следующих запусках.

Новое действие находится в разделе Добавить действие → Android → Действия с виртуальной машиной → Выбрать.




Выбор языка системы

Мы добавили возможность выбрать подходящий язык эмулятора (en, ko, de, ja, fr, ru, es, pt, hr, cn, sr, it, cs, th, in, pl, tr, uk, ar, vi, fil).

Новое действие находится в разделе Добавить действие → Android → Действия с виртуальной машиной → Установка языка.




Добавлена опция регулировки продолжительности свайпа

Находится в разделе Добавить действие → Android → Эмуляция Swipe.

Продолжительность свайпа указывается в миллисекундах.


 
Последнее редактирование модератором:

ZennoLab Team

Super Moderator
Команда форума
Регистрация
22.01.2019
Сообщения
1 501
Благодарностей
3 748
Баллы
113
Как сообщать о проблемах?

Просьба сообщать обо всех багах в Бегтрекере, сопровождая проблему подробным описанием и сценарием воспроизведения.
Это позволит нам быстро диагностировать и исправить ошибку.


Обсуждение релиза 2.2.4.0

Оставьте здесь свой отзыв или комментарий о новом ZennoDroid.
Мы будем рады!
 
Последнее редактирование модератором:
  • Спасибо
Реакции: melutsk

ibred

Client
Регистрация
04.04.2015
Сообщения
3 835
Благодарностей
3 552
Баллы
113
Для владельцев ZennoDroid Lite:

Возможность апгрейда с ZennoDroid Lite до ZennoDroid Pro временно недоступна.
Она будет восстановлена в самое ближайшее время.

Пока что можете ознакомиться со всеми новыми функциями, которые доступны не только в ZennoDroid Pro, но и Lite версии :-)

UPD: Работа восстановлена
 
Последнее редактирование:
  • Спасибо
Реакции: melutsk, Bkmz и Kiriller

Iv1

Client
Регистрация
21.02.2016
Сообщения
1 947
Благодарностей
767
Баллы
113
  • Спасибо
Реакции: melutsk

Iv1

Client
Регистрация
21.02.2016
Сообщения
1 947
Благодарностей
767
Баллы
113
Мы добавили возможность выбрать подходящий язык эмулятора (en, ko, de, ja, fr, ru, es, pt, hr, cn, sr, it, cs, th, in, pl, tr, uk, ar, vi, fil).

Новое действие находится в разделе Добавить действие → Android → Действия с виртуальной машиной → Установка языка.
Нет проблемы в языке эмулятора)
Есть проблема с локализацией всего устройства (например если делаешь под Германию, то все поля андройда должны быть локализованы достоверными данными под Германию)
 
  • Спасибо
Реакции: melutsk

Gunjubasik

Client
Регистрация
30.05.2019
Сообщения
3 521
Благодарностей
1 319
Баллы
113
1. Будет ли добавлено в перспективе работа через xpath в приложениях (что-то придумать на подобии DevTools) и планируется ли ввобще?
2. Планируется ли добавить перехват трафика из приложений, как сейчас в зеннопостере вкладка Трафик?
3. Что-то по анонимности предложить планируете, что бы скрыть эмулятор или пока нет?
 
  • Спасибо
Реакции: melutsk

Iv1

Client
Регистрация
21.02.2016
Сообщения
1 947
Благодарностей
767
Баллы
113
Возможность сохранения и восстановления данных приложения
Это "половинчатое решение проблемы"
Потому что приложение не только могут содержать разные данные, но и быть разных версий, где даже интерфейс меняется, а за ним и порядок кубиков чтобы с ним работать.
Потому надо еще и само приложение бекапить и восстанавливать.
 
  • Спасибо
Реакции: melutsk и Konrod_m

Iv1

Client
Регистрация
21.02.2016
Сообщения
1 947
Благодарностей
767
Баллы
113
А в целом релизу рад)
хоть и не сразу, но функционал появляется
 
  • Спасибо
Реакции: melutsk, ibred и ruthless

ruthless

Client
Регистрация
13.02.2017
Сообщения
226
Благодарностей
67
Баллы
28
Для владельцев ZennoDroid Lite:

Возможность апгрейда с ZennoDroid Lite до ZennoDroid Pro временно недоступна.
Она будет восстановлена в самое ближайшее время.

Пока что можете ознакомиться со всеми новыми функциями, которые доступны не только в ZennoDroid Pro, но и Lite версии :-)
интересно, будем ждать
 
  • Спасибо
Реакции: melutsk

ibred

Client
Регистрация
04.04.2015
Сообщения
3 835
Благодарностей
3 552
Баллы
113
Тут вы конечно перегнули...
Справка пока ещё в процессе написания, поэтому кнопка "?" может присутствовать не везде. Совсем скоро мы допишем справочные материалы и расставим кнопки там, где их не хватает.

1. Будет ли добавлено в перспективе работа через xpath в приложениях (что-то придумать на подобии DevTools) и планируется ли ввобще?
Поиск по XPath реализуем, но точных сроков по задаче пока нет.
Подскажите, где-то не получается без xPath найти элемент?

2. Планируется ли добавить перехват трафика из приложений, как сейчас в зеннопостере вкладка Трафик?
3. Что-то по анонимности предложить планируете, что бы скрыть эмулятор или пока нет?
Вернусь с ответом чуть позже.

Потому что приложение не только могут содержать разные данные, но и быть разных версий, где даже интерфейс меняется, а за ним и порядок кубиков чтобы с ним работать.
Потому надо еще и само приложение бекапить и восстанавливать.
Для этого можно сохранить *.apk файл приложения (нужной версии) и устанавливать его через специальный экшен (а не из Google Play) перед восстановлением сессии. Тогда проблем не будет :-)
 
  • Спасибо
Реакции: melutsk и SHILY

Iv1

Client
Регистрация
21.02.2016
Сообщения
1 947
Благодарностей
767
Баллы
113
Поиск по XPath реализуем, но точных сроков по задаче пока нет.
Подскажите, где-то не получается без xPath найти элемент
В гугл плей там почти все обфускер))
Там даже по картинке не всегда находит, а кубиком через XML почти никогда
 
  • Спасибо
Реакции: melutsk

ibred

Client
Регистрация
04.04.2015
Сообщения
3 835
Благодарностей
3 552
Баллы
113
В гугл плей там почти все обфускер))
Там даже по картинке не всегда находит, а кубиком через XML почти никогда
Изучим вопрос, спасибо за подробности :-)
 
  • Спасибо
Реакции: melutsk, SHILY и Iv1

Iv1

Client
Регистрация
21.02.2016
Сообщения
1 947
Благодарностей
767
Баллы
113
Для этого можно сохранить *.apk файл приложения (нужной версии) и устанавливать его через специальный экшен (а не из Google Play) перед восстановлением сессии. Тогда проблем не будет
А где его взять?))
Есть сервисы, которые пипа умеют с google play доставать, но они любят переупаковывать и иногда криво очень достают.
Потому это не так тривиально, как кажется.
 
  • Спасибо
Реакции: melutsk

DenisK

Client
Регистрация
28.06.2016
Сообщения
591
Благодарностей
289
Баллы
63
А в чем отличие лайта от про? Лайт один поток, а про сколько?

Спасибо за релиз!
 
  • Спасибо
Реакции: melutsk

Iv1

Client
Регистрация
21.02.2016
Сообщения
1 947
Благодарностей
767
Баллы
113
А в чем отличие лайта от про? Лайт один поток, а про сколько?

Спасибо за релиз!
Лайт - прямо вообще один поток
Даже если несколько проектов запущено, то все равно только что-то одно выполняется
Про - можно все одновременно пока комп не задымится
 
  • Спасибо
Реакции: melutsk и DenisK

Gunjubasik

Client
Регистрация
30.05.2019
Сообщения
3 521
Благодарностей
1 319
Баллы
113
Подскажите, где-то не получается без xPath найти элемент?
Та интересует не так сам xpath, а отсутствие что-то на подобии Dev Tool - где можно посмотреть код приложения и вносить правки, но сомневаюсь что это реализуемо, особенно для гибкого нахождения капч и т.д.
 
  • Спасибо
Реакции: melutsk

VladZen

Administrator
Команда форума
Регистрация
05.11.2014
Сообщения
22 453
Благодарностей
5 912
Баллы
113
А где его взять?))
Есть сервисы, которые пипа умеют с google play доставать, но они любят переупаковывать и иногда криво очень достают.
Потому это не так тривиально, как кажется.
apk извлекается уже после установки из Google Play, например вот так.
 
  • Спасибо
Реакции: melutsk и Iv1

Iv1

Client
Регистрация
21.02.2016
Сообщения
1 947
Благодарностей
767
Баллы
113
  • Спасибо
Реакции: melutsk

Mikhail B.

Client
Регистрация
23.12.2014
Сообщения
14 415
Благодарностей
5 454
Баллы
113
Отлично что дроид стал активнее обновлятся.
 
  • Спасибо
Реакции: melutsk

DenisK

Client
Регистрация
28.06.2016
Сообщения
591
Благодарностей
289
Баллы
63
Я вот не понимаю как в личном кабинете апгрейд сделать с лайта до про... Уже пару раз заходил и никак не пойму.
 
  • Спасибо
Реакции: melutsk

Sergodjan

Administrator
Команда форума
Регистрация
05.09.2012
Сообщения
20 407
Благодарностей
9 115
Баллы
113
Я вот не понимаю как в личном кабинете апгрейд сделать с лайта до про... Уже пару раз заходил и никак не пойму.
Апгрейд функция для ЗД пока недоступна, совсем скоро будет сделано.
 
  • Спасибо
Реакции: melutsk и DenisK

DenisK

Client
Регистрация
28.06.2016
Сообщения
591
Благодарностей
289
Баллы
63
  • Спасибо
Реакции: melutsk

Ingvar

Client
Регистрация
28.11.2019
Сообщения
32
Благодарностей
17
Баллы
8
Подскажите, модель продажи такая же как у Lite версии? Годовая подписка?
 
  • Спасибо
Реакции: melutsk

ibred

Client
Регистрация
04.04.2015
Сообщения
3 835
Благодарностей
3 552
Баллы
113
  • Спасибо
Реакции: melutsk и Ingvar

mr.green

Client
Регистрация
26.09.2019
Сообщения
211
Благодарностей
125
Баллы
43
Все верно, программа приобретается на 1 год. Все обновления в этот периодв включены.
После года не возможно будет использовать ZD без покупки продления?
 
  • Спасибо
Реакции: vrska и melutsk

Juniorcpa

Client
Регистрация
27.05.2014
Сообщения
2 031
Благодарностей
1 286
Баллы
113
о, бекапы приложений реализовали из коробки, красавцы.
 
  • Спасибо
Реакции: melutsk

melutsk

Client
Регистрация
03.08.2016
Сообщения
1 348
Благодарностей
1 259
Баллы
113
Обнова супер, только переход из лайт в про было б заебумба побыстрее сделать *ломка*.
 
  • Спасибо
Реакции: Mikhail B.

Iv1

Client
Регистрация
21.02.2016
Сообщения
1 947
Благодарностей
767
Баллы
113
  • Спасибо
Реакции: melutsk

melutsk

Client
Регистрация
03.08.2016
Сообщения
1 348
Благодарностей
1 259
Баллы
113

radv

Client
Регистрация
11.05.2015
Сообщения
3 788
Благодарностей
1 952
Баллы
113

Кто просматривает тему: (Всего: 1, Пользователи: 0, Гости: 1)